Catherine Yoshida is a scholar working on Food Science, Endocrinology and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Catherine Yoshida has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 273 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Food Science, 8 papers in Endocrinology and 5 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Catherine Yoshida's work include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(11 papers), Vibrio bacteria research studies (8 papers) and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(5 papers). Catherine Yoshida is often cited by papers focused on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(11 papers), Vibrio bacteria research studies (8 papers) and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(5 papers). Catherine Yoshida collaborates with scholars based in Canada, Austria and United Kingdom. Catherine Yoshida's co-authors include James A. Robertson, Eduardo N. Taboada, Anil Nichani, John J. Nash, Andrew M. Kropinski, Peter Kruczkiewicz, Céline Nadon, Kristyn Franklin, Erika J. Lingohr and Sara Christianson and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Clinical Microbiology and Frontiers in Microbiology.
